/**
* Converts a WSDL file or URL resource into a .NET language.
*
* Why add a wrapper to the MS WSDL tool?
* So that you can verify that your web services, be they written with Axis or
*anyone else's SOAP toolkit, work with .NET clients.
*
*This task is dependency aware when using a file as a source and destination;
*so if you &lt;get&gt; the file (with <code>usetimestamp="true"</code>) then
*you only rebuild stuff when the WSDL file is changed. Of course,
*if the server generates a new timestamp every time you ask for the WSDL,
*this is not enough...use the &lt;filesmatch&gt; &lt;condition&gt; to
*to byte for byte comparison against a cached WSDL file then make
*the target conditional on that test failing.
* See "Creating an XML Web Service Proxy", "wsdl.exe" docs in
* the framework SDK documentation
* @version 0.5
* @ant.task category="dotnet"
* @since Ant 1.5
*/
